Why These Are the Top Toyota Repair Auto Repair Shops in Adin

The Toyota repair market serving Adin, California, is characterized by its rural nature. There are no dedicated Toyota dealerships or nationally recognized specialist chains within a short drive. The market consists of independent, locally-owned auto repair shops in hub towns like Alturas, Susanville, and Fall River Mills. Competition is moderate, with a few established providers dominating the region. The quality of service is generally high, as these businesses rely heavily on community reputation and long-term customer relationships. Pricing is typically competitive for a rural area but may be higher than in urban centers due to lower parts availability and the need for shops to be generalists. For highly complex issues, particularly with newer hybrids or advanced electronics, residents may face a longer drive to a major city like Reno, NV, or Redding, CA, to access a Toyota dealership. The providers listed are the most capable and trusted local options for the vast majority of Toyota repair needs.

Are Toyota repair services more expensive in Adin due to our remote location?

Labor rates in Adin are generally competitive, but parts availability can sometimes lead to longer wait times and slightly higher costs for expedited shipping. Building a relationship with a local shop that has reliable parts suppliers is key to managing costs for your Toyota.

What are the most common Toyota repairs needed for vehicles driven on Adin's rural roads and in winter conditions?

Given the gravel roads, winter snow, and summer dust, suspension components (like struts and control arms), brakes, and air filters see increased wear. Toyota trucks and SUVs, like Tacomas and 4Runners common here, also frequently need 4WD system servicing.

When should I seek local service versus going to a dealership for my Toyota?

For most routine maintenance (oil changes, brakes, tires) and common repairs, Adin's local shops are fully capable. For highly complex hybrid system issues or warranty-covered repairs, you may need to travel to a dealership in a larger city like Redding or Susanville.

How can I find a quality, trustworthy Toyota repair shop in the Adin area?

Ask neighbors and local ranchers for personal recommendations, as word-of-mouth is strong here. Look for a shop with certified technicians (ASE or Toyota-specific training) and one that is willing to explain repairs clearly and source quality parts.

What local considerations should I keep in mind when scheduling Toyota service in Adin?

Schedule ahead, especially before winter or summer road trip seasons, as local shops can get busy. Also, discuss your typical driving—such as towing, ranch work, or frequent trips on Highway 299—with your mechanic so they can prioritize inspections for those specific stresses.
